Frequently Asked Questions about Jersey City
How much are Studio apartments in Jersey City?
There are currently 6,083 Studio Apartments in Jersey City with rent ranges from $1,060 to $12,840 with an average price of $3,357.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jersey City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jersey City ranges from $1,100 to $19,260 with an average monthly rent of $3,923.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jersey City c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jersey City range from $1,649 to $21,624.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,838.
How expensive are Jersey City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 1,059 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jersey City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,775 to $32,100 - averaging $5,188 for the location.
